【问题标题】:SSAS measure value aggregate errorSSAS 测量值聚合误差
【发布时间】:2016-03-22 15:50:08
【问题描述】:

我有一个包含以下行的事实表

当我处理我的立方体时,我想要这样的结果:

但是,当我处理我的立方体时,我得到以下结果:

我有费率(小时费率)作为衡量标准,但它会在 LineID 相同时对值求和(请参阅以红色突出显示的值),即使日期和开始时间不同。

如何更改我的 Hourlyrate 度量以仅显示唯一值而不是总和?我尝试将 AggregationFunction 更改为 None 但这给了我空值。

【问题讨论】:

    标签: ssas olap cube olap-cube ssas-2012


    【解决方案1】:

    您在解释您的要求和问题方面做得很差。

    无论如何,我会尝试将您的 Coll Fee Rate 度量的 AggregationFunction 更改为 Max。这将显示最高的潜在价值。

    【讨论】:

      【解决方案2】:

      尝试将“费率”度量的 AggregationFunction 更改为 AverageOfChildren

      更多详情

      https://msdn.microsoft.com/en-us/library/ms365396.aspx

      【讨论】:

      • 当每行的费率相同时,这是可以的。但是,当费率不同时,我得到的是费率总和的一行,而不是每个费率的一行。
      【解决方案3】:

      我设法通过创建一个包含费率的维度表来解决这个问题,然后用它来确定费率

      【讨论】:

        猜你喜欢
        • 1970-01-01
        • 1970-01-01
        • 2021-02-22
        • 1970-01-01
        • 1970-01-01
        • 1970-01-01
        • 1970-01-01
        • 1970-01-01
        • 1970-01-01
        相关资源
        最近更新 更多